Hello everyone, Bendorsey has done it again by scratching off another building on "Things need to be made" list. He has finished this building of this 1920's Sunoco Gas Station building that IRM acquired many years ago from the state of Ohio, the real one has yet to find a permanent spot on the museum grounds but for now the real one is being stored by the Museum's Buildings and Grounds Department buildings all boarded up since right now the museum needs to first finished the restoration on the Schroder Store Building first before they could move onto this project. Here is a screenshot of Ben's model below (Note the Gas Pumps, these are not made by bendorsey and were made by someone else and are standing in for now. Im trying to contact the original creator of these gas pumps to see if he can do a Sunoco Version since the two gas pumps IRM got for the real one, came with it are based on this type of Gas Pump).
